DevMedia - asp.net, Java, Delphi, SQL e web Design, tudo em um só lugar!
Bem vindo a DevMedia!
LOGIN:     SENHA:
 
 

  Este é um post disponível para assinantes MVP
Este post também está disponível para assinantes da SQL Magazine DIGITAL
ou para quem possui Créditos DevMedia.  Clique aqui para saber mais!

artigo SQL Magazine 04 - SQL Server – Primeiros Passos

Artigo da Revista SQL Magazine -Edição 4.

Atenção: por essa edição ser muito antiga não há arquivo PDF para download.
Os artigos dessa edição estão disponíveis somente através do formato HTML.

Clique aqui para ler todos os artigos desta edição

SQL Server – Primeiros Passos

 

Veremos neste artigo como construir um banco de dados no SQL Server 2000 através do Enterprise Manager. Mostraremos em algumas etapas a criação do banco e de seus componentes mais essenciais, como tabelas, índices e relacionamentos. Nosso banco de dados será chamado MiniNegocio, e será composto de duas tabelas: Clientes e Pedidos.  

 

Introdução às ferramentas do SQL Server

 

         O SQL Server é um sistema de gerenciamento de banco de dados cliente/servidor da Microsoft. Das principais ferramentas visuais de administração, destacaremos duas: o Enterprise Manager (Figura 1) e o Query Analyzer (Figura 2):

         Enterprise Manager: Funciona como um painel de controle dos objetos, serviços e operações do SQL Server. É dividido em três seções:

·         Um painel esquerdo contendo uma árvore que permite a navegação entre os servidores e seus respectivos objetos (bancos de dados, usuários, regras e outros).

·         Um painel direito contendo a representação dos itens selecionados na árvore à esquerda.

·         Um menu e uma barra de ferramentas contendo atalhos para as principais funcionalidades do gerenciador.

        

Query Analyser: É uma ferramenta gráfica para execução de comandos SQL e Transact-SQL (uma extensão da SQL, contendo rotinas procedurais). O Query Analyzer também fornece alguns serviços, como plano de execução de queries (fornecendo o tempo de CPU, leitura de disco rígido, entre outras informações), XX e YYY.

 

Consideração sobre Bancos de Dados no SQL Server

 

         Além dos bancos criados pelo administrador, o SQL Server contém quatro bancos de dados de sistema: (master, model, tempdb, msdb), que são criados durante a instalação. Vejamos o papel de cada um:

 

master (tamanho inicial: 16 Mb): Contém informações sobre processos em execução, contas de login, bloqueios, entre outros.

 

model (tamanho inicial: 2.5Mb): É usado como modelo para criação de novos bancos de dados, permitindo definir padrões como autorizações default de usuário e opções de configuração. Um novo banco de dados recebe o conteúdo de model durante sua criação.

 

tempdb (tamanho inicial: 8 Mb): É usado para armazenar tabelas temporárias e resultados intermediários de consultas. Geralmente o seu conteúdo é excluído sempre que um usuário se desconecta.

 

msdb (tamanho inicial: 12 Mb): É usado pelo serviço SQLServerAgent, para controlar tarefas como replicação, agendamento de tarefas, backups e alertas.

 

Existem também  tabelas do sistema que são  armazenadas no banco de dados master e em cada banco de dados de usuário. Elas contêm informações sobre o SQL Server e sobre cada banco de dados de usuário. Existem 17 tabelas em cada banco de dados que formam o catálogo do banco de dados.e que  começam com o prefixo sys.

 

         Um banco pode ser composto de diferentes tipos de arquivos físicos:

"

A exibição deste artigo foi interrompida.

  Este é um post disponível para assinantes MVP
Este post também está disponível para assinantes da SQL Magazine DIGITAL
ou para quem possui Créditos DevMedia.  Clique aqui para saber mais!


Equipe Devmedia
Noticias/Dicas/Artigos publicados.
O que você achou deste post?

    0 COMENTÁRIO

[Fechar]

Este post é fechado - você precisa ter acesso ao post para incluir um comentário.


Nenhum comentário foi postado - seja o primeiro a comentar!
Cursos relacionados
Publicidade
[Fechar]

Você precisa estar logado para dar um feedback.

Clique aqui para efetuar o login
[Fechar]


Este post está fechado. Saiba mais sobre a assinatura MVP!
web-03
DevMedia  |  Anuncie  |  Fale conosco
Hospedagem web por Porta 80 Web Hosting
2013 - Todos os Direitos Reservados a web-03